India’s IT services industry is entering a phase where scale alone may no longer be enough to sustain its traditional business model, as artificial intelligence (AI) changes the economics of software work and pushes clients towards specialised expertise, platforms and measurable outcomes, according to Nigel Vaz, CEO of Publicis Sapient.
The shift comes as India’s technology sector continues to grow, but workforce expansion has become far more measured. The country’s technology industry is expected to reach $315 billion in revenue in FY26, while direct employment is projected to reach about 6 million, with net additions of 135,000. Nasscom has also highlighted a broader shift from scale-led growth towards value and innovation as AI productivity gains increasingly flow through the sector.
Nasscom’s own assessment of the sector points to a similar transition. In its Strategic Review 2026, the industry body said Indian technology providers were “re-engineering revenue models”, moving away from FTE-led delivery towards outcome-based and risk-sharing models as AI-driven productivity gains materialise. It expects India’s technology sector to cross $315 billion in FY26, while direct employment reaches around 6 million, with 135,000 net additions. Nasscom also expects hiring to shift “from volume to skill mix” as AI-driven productivity gains are passed on to clients.
For Vaz, this is not simply a cyclical change in hiring. It represents a fundamental shift in what clients will pay technology service providers for. “IT services is going to continue to be valuable as long as we don't perpetuate the model of cost arbitrage, human scale and repetitive work,” Vaz said in an interaction with Fortune India. “The value is going to move from repetitive tasks being done by people at scale to expertise.”
Vaz compared the emerging model with a small group of highly equipped “Navy SEALs” rather than an army of hundreds of thousands of people performing repetitive tasks. With AI and the right platforms, he said, a much smaller group can achieve a dramatically different outcome.
“There’s still going to be massive numbers of people that are needed to help every company in the world become AI-first,” Vaz said. But the capabilities of those people, and the platforms they work with, will have to change.
GCCs add another layer of pressure
The rise of global capability centres (GCCs) in India is reinforcing the shift away from the traditional outsourcing model. India had 2,117 GCCs across 3,728 units employing about 2.36 million professionals as of FY26, generating $98.4 billion in revenue, according to the Nasscom-Zinnov GCC Landscape 2026 report. The number of GCCs has grown 32% since FY2021, while nearly half of the GCCs established since FY2021 were built with AI as a core focus from inception.
Vaz sees GCC growth as both a challenge and an opportunity for technology service providers. “GCCs are created for two reasons. One is cost arbitrage and the other is skill and capabilities,” he said. The opportunity for companies such as Publicis Sapient, he argued, is not to replicate the old model of “hiring thousands and thousands of people”, but to help companies build systems, products and AI platforms around specialised talent.
That distinction is increasingly important as global companies build in-house technology and product capabilities in India. For service providers, the opportunity shifts from supplying labour to helping build the platforms, products and operating models that allow those teams to work more effectively.
For enterprises, the problem is also legacy tech
That is closely aligned with Publicis Sapient’s own business, which focuses on digital business transformation and modernising enterprise technology. Vaz argues that AI’s biggest opportunity may not be simply automating existing work, but rethinking how businesses operate.
Large enterprises still carry decades of technology debt, including mainframes and applications written in COBOL. Publicis Sapient has built Sapient Slingshot to address this problem by ingesting legacy code, generating specifications and allowing users to describe what they need in English before generating modern code. “The process that could have taken 10 years, we can do in under three,” Vaz said.
But the problem extends beyond code. Vaz said enterprises also have legacy processes that remain manual and inefficient. He cited an insurance use case in which external information such as ambient air quality could trigger proactive customer support, and a banking onboarding process that could be reduced from 17 or 27 steps to one or two using agents and connected data, with customer permission. Publicis Sapient is deploying platforms including Slingshot, Bodhi and Sustain alongside people to tackle technology debt, process redesign, governance and organisational change.
Vaz is similarly sceptical of the corporate obsession with becoming “AI-native”. “AI-native is already a misconception because you can’t become AI-native,” he said. His advice to boards and CEOs is instead straightforward, “Focus on the outcomes, not the technology.”
